Ingredients

  • 4 tablespoons butter, divided
  • 3 tablespoons flour plus about 1/3 cup for dredging chicken
  • 1 cup chicken stock
  • 1 cup half-and-half, warmed
  • Salt and pepper
  • 1/2 cup grated Gruyère cheese
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ese
  • 4 bone-in, skin-on chicken breasts
  • 3 bundles broccolini or baby broccoli
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il, divided
  • 2 to 3 large cloves garlic, chopped
  • 1 lemon
  • Crispy onions, to garnish
